咪达普利、缬沙坦抑制动脉粥样硬化的作用及机制

摘    要:目的研究咪达普利,缬沙坦抑制动脉粥样硬化的作用及其机制。方法40只纯种大白兔随机分为4组。喂养8周后测定各组血清中总胴固醇(TC)、甘油三酯(TG)及低密度脂蛋白胆固醇(LDL),免疫组化观察粥样硬化斑块中STAT3、P21、CDK4的表达情况。结果高脂组、药物干预组血清TC、TG、LDL—C水平较对照组显著升高。STAT3、CDK4在药物干预组中表达较高脂组明显减少.而P21在药物干预组的表达较高脂组则明显升高。结论咪达普利、缬沙坦可明显抑制动脉粥样硬化的发生,其机制可能与抑制STAT3的信号传导和平滑肌增值有关。

The effect of imidapril and valsartan on inhibiting the development of atherosclerosis and its mechanism

Abstract:Objective To investigate the effect of imidapril and valsartan on inhibiting the development of atherosclerosis. Methods The rabbits were randomly divided into four groups. Blood samples were collected at the end of 8 weeks for examination of serum lipid levels and the expression of STAT3, P21, CDK4 were detected by immunohistochemistry. Results Rabbits fed with cholesterol-rich diet showed higher serum lipid levels than those fed with normal diet. The expression of STAT3, CDK4 in imidapril treated group and valsartan treated group decreased significantly than those of high cholesterol group, while the expression of P21 of imidapril treated group and valsartan treated group is higher than those of high cholesterol group. Conclusion Valsartan, imidapril can inhibit atherosclerotic progression, the mechanism may be related to inhibition of the signal conduction of STAT3 and proliferation of vascular smooth muscle cells in atherosclerosis.
